What are the types of Polio?

Type 1 or Brunhilde - most common and was most often the cause of epidemics Type 2 or Lansing - least common Type 3 or Leon All three types are included in the vaccine.


What is the medical condition polio?

Polio is a disease caused by the poliovirus. In its most severe form polio causes paralysis of the muscles of the legs, arms, and respiratory system.

How polio is spread?

Polio is transmitted, most commonly, through fecal matter and saliva.
